Asteroid’s sudden flyby shows blind spot in planetary threat detection

WASHINGTON, Jan 29 (Reuters) – The discovery of an asteroid the size of a small shipping truck mere days before it passed Earth on Thursday, albeit one that posed no threat to humans, highlights a blind spot in our ability to predict those that could actually cause damage, astronomers say.

NASA for years has prioritized detecting asteroids much bigger and more existentially threatening than 2023 BU, the small space rock that streaked by 2,200 miles from the Earth’s surface, closer than some satellites. If bound for Earth, it would have been pulverized in the atmosphere, with only small fragments possibly reaching land.

But 2023 BU sits on the smaller end of a size group, asteroids 5-to-50 meters in diameter, that also includes those as big as an Olympic swimming pool. Objects that size are difficult to detect until they wander much closer to Earth, complicating any efforts to brace for one that could impact a populated area.

The probability of an Earth impact by a space rock, called a meteor when it enters the atmosphere, of that size range is fairly low, scaling according to the asteroid’s size: a 5-meter rock is estimated to target Earth once a year, and a 50-meter rock once every thousand years, according to NASA.

But with current capabilities, astronomers can’t see when such a rock targets Earth until days prior.

“We don’t know where most of the asteroids are that can cause local to regional devastation,” said Terik Daly, a planetary scientist at the Johns Hopkins Applied Physics Laboratory.

The roughly 20-meter meteor that exploded in 2013 over Chelyabinsk, Russia is a once-every-100-years event, according to NASA’s Jet Propulsion Laboratory. It created a shockwave that shattered tens of thousands of windows and caused $33 million in damage, and no one saw it coming before it entered Earth’s atmosphere.

Some astronomers consider relying only on statistical probabilities and estimates of asteroid populations an unnecessary risk, when improvements could be made to NASA’s ability to detect them.

“How many natural hazards are there that we could actually do something about and prevent for a billion dollars? There’s not many,” said Daly, whose work focuses on defending Earth from hazardous asteroids.

AVOIDING A REALLY BAD DAY

One major upgrade to NASA’s detection arsenal will be NEO Surveyor, a $1.2 billion telescope under development that will launch nearly a million miles from Earth and surveil a wide field of asteroids. It promises a significant advantage over today’s ground-based telescopes that are hindered by daytime light and Earth’s atmosphere.

That new telescope will help NASA meet a goal assigned by Congress in 2005: detect 90% of the total expected amount of asteroids bigger than 140 meters, or those big enough to destroy anything from a region to an entire continent.

“With Surveyor, we’re really focusing on finding the one asteroid that could cause a really bad day for a lot of people,” said Amy Mainzer, NEO Surveyor principal investigator. “But we’re also tasked with getting good statistics on the smaller objects, down to about the size of the Chelyabinsk object.”

NASA has fallen years behind on its congressional goal, which was ordered for completion by 2020. The agency proposed last year to cut the telescope’s 2023 budget by three quarters and a two-year launch delay to 2028 “to support higher-priority missions” elsewhere in NASA’s science portfolio.

Asteroid detection gained greater importance last year after NASA slammed a refrigerator-sized spacecraft into an asteroid to test its ability to knock a potentially hazardous space rock off a collision course with Earth.

The successful demonstration, called the Double Asteroid Redirection Test (DART), affirmed for the first time a method of planetary defense.

“NEO Surveyor is of the utmost importance, especially now that we know from DART that we really can do something about it,” Daly said.

“So by golly, we gotta find these asteroids.”

U.S. to test nuclear-powered spacecraft by 2027

WASHINGTON, Jan 24 (Reuters) – The United States plans to test a spacecraft engine powered by nuclear fission by 2027 as part of a long-term NASA effort to demonstrate more efficient methods of propelling astronauts to Mars in the future, the space agency’s chief said on Tuesday.

NASA will partner with the U.S. military’s research and development agency, DARPA, to develop a nuclear thermal propulsion engine and launch it to space “as soon as 2027,” NASA administrator Bill Nelson said during a conference in National Harbor, Maryland.

The U.S. space agency has studied for decades the concept of nuclear thermal propulsion, which introduces heat from a nuclear fission reactor to a hydrogen propellant in order to provide a thrust believed to be far more efficient than traditional chemical-based rocket engines.

NASA officials view nuclear thermal propulsion as crucial for sending humans beyond the moon and deeper into space. A trip to Mars from Earth using the technology could take roughly four months instead of some nine months with a conventional, chemically powered engine, engineers say.

That would substantially reduce the time astronauts would be exposed to deep-space radiation and would also require fewer supplies, such as food and other cargo, during a trip to Mars.

“If we have swifter trips for humans, they are safer trips,” NASA deputy administrator and former astronaut Pam Melroy said Tuesday.

The planned 2027 demonstration, part of an existing DARPA research program that NASA is now joining, could also inform the ambitions of the U.S. Space Force, which has envisioned deploying nuclear reactor-powered spacecraft capable of moving other satellites orbiting near the moon, DARPA and NASA officials said.

DARPA in 2021 awarded funds to General Atomics, Lockheed Martin and Jeff Bezos’ space company Blue Origin to study designs of nuclear reactors and spacecraft. By around March, the agency will pick a company to build the nuclear spacecraft for the 2027 demonstration, the program’s manager Tabitha Dodson said in an interview.

The joint NASA-DARPA effort’s budget is $110 million for fiscal year 2023 and is expected to be hundreds of millions of dollars more through 2027.

One year after volcanic blast, many of Tonga’s reefs lay silent

Jan 15 (Reuters) – One year on from the massive eruption of an underwater volcano in the South Pacific, the island nation of Tonga is still dealing with the damage to its coastal waters.

When Hunga-Tonga-Hunga Ha’apai went off, it sent a shockwave around the world, produced a plume of water and ash that soared higher into the atmosphere than any other on record, and triggered tsunami waves that ricocheted across the region – slamming into the archipelago which lies southeast of Fiji.

Coral reefs were turned to rubble and many fish perished or migrated away.

The result has Tongans struggling, with more than 80% of Tongan families relying on subsistence reef fishing, according 2019 data from the World Bank. Following the eruption, the Tongan government said it would seek $240 million for recovery, including improving food security. In the immediate aftermath, the World Bank provided $8 million.

“In terms of recovery plan … we are awaiting for funds to cover expenditure associated with small-scale fisheries along coastal communities,” said Poasi Ngaluafe, head of the science division of Tonga’s Ministry of Fisheries.

SILENT REEFS

The vast majority of Tongan territory is ocean, with its exclusive economic zone extending across nearly 700,000 square kilometres (270,271 square miles) of water. While commercial fisheries contribute only 2.3% to the national economy, subsistence fishing is considered crucial in making up a staple of the Tongan diet.

The U.N.’s Food and Agricultural Organization estimated in a November report that the eruption cost the country’s fisheries and aquaculture sector some $7.4 million – a significant number for Tonga’s roughly $500 million economy. The losses were largely due to damaged fishing vessels, with nearly half of that damage in the small-scale fisheries sector, though some commercial vessels were also affected.

Because the Tongan government does not closely track subsistence fishing, it is difficult to estimate the eruption’s impact on fish harvests.

But scientists say that, apart from some fish stocks likely being depleted, there are other troubling signs that suggest it could take a long time for fisheries to recover.

Young corals are failing to mature in the coastal waters around the eruption site, and many areas once home to healthy and abundant reefs are now barren, according to the government’s August survey.

It is likely volcanic ash smothered many reefs, depriving fish of feeding areas and spawning beds. The survey found that no marine life had survived near the volcano.

Meanwhile, the tsunami that swelled in the waters around the archipelago knocked over large boulder corals, creating fields of coral rubble. And while some reefs survived, the crackling, snapping and popping noises of foraging shrimp and fish, a sign of a healthy environment, were gone.

“The reefs in Tonga were silent,” the survey report found.

FARMING REPRIEVE

Agriculture has proved a lifeline to Tongans facing empty waters and damaged boats. Despite concerns that the volcanic ash, which blanketed 99% of the country, would make soils too toxic to grow crops, “food production has resumed with little impacts,” said Siosiua Halavatu, a soil scientist speaking on behalf of the Tongan government.

Soil tests revealed that the fallen ash was not harmful for humans. And while yam and sweet potato plants perished during the eruption, and fruit trees were burned by falling ash, they began to recover once the ash was washed away.

“We have supported recovery works through land preparation, and planting backyard gardening and roots crops in the farms, as well as export crops like watermelon and squash,” Halavatu told Reuters.

But long-term monitoring will be critical, he said, and Tonga hopes to develop a national soil strategy and upgrade their soil testing laboratory to help farmers.

SKY WATER

Scientists are also now taking stock of the eruption’s impact on the atmosphere. While volcanic eruptions on land eject mostly ash and sulfur dioxide, underwater volcanos jettison far more water.

Tonga’s eruption was no different, with the blast’s white-grayish plume reaching 57 kilometers (35.4 miles) and injecting 146 million tonnes of water into the atmosphere.

Water vapor can linger in the atmosphere for up to a decade, trapping heat on Earth’s surface and leading to more overall warming. More atmospheric water vapor can also help deplete ozone, which shields the planet from harmful UV radiation.

“That one volcano increased the total amount of global water in the stratosphere by 10 percent,” said Paul Newman, chief scientist for earth sciences at NASA’s Goddard Space Flight Center. “We’re only now beginning to see the impact of that.”

Russia to rescue ISS crew on backup rocket after capsule leak

Jan 11 (Reuters) – Russia said on Wednesday it would launch another Soyuz spacecraft next month to bring home two cosmonauts and a U.S. astronaut from the International Space Station after their original capsule was struck by a micrometeoroid and started leaking last month.

The leak came from a tiny puncture – less than 1 millimetre wide – on the external cooling system of the Soyuz MS-22 capsule, one of two return capsules docked to the ISS that can bring crew members home.

Russia said a new capsule, Soyuz MS-23, would be sent up on Feb. 20 to replace the damaged Soyuz MS-22, which will be brought back to Earth empty.

“Having analysed the condition of the spacecraft, thermal calculations and technical documentation, it has been concluded that the MS-22 must be landed without a crew on board,” said Yuri Borisov, the head of Russian space agency Roscosmos.

Russian cosmonauts Sergey Prokopyev and Dmitry Petelin and U.S. astronaut Francisco Rubio had been due to end their mission in March but will now extend it by a few more months and return aboard the MS-23.

“They are ready to go with whatever decision we give them,” Joel Montalbano, NASA’s ISS program manager, told a news conference. “I may have to fly some more ice cream to reward them,” he added.

“SPACE IS NOT A SAFE PLACE”

The MS-23, which had been due to take up three new crew in March, will instead depart from the Baikonur cosmodrome in Kazakhstan as an unmanned rescue mission next month.

If there is an emergency in the meantime, Roscosmos said it will look at whether the MS-22 spacecraft can be used to rescue the crew. In this scenario, temperatures in the capsule could reach unhealthy levels of 30-40 degrees Celsius (86-104 degrees Fahrenheit).

“In case of an emergency, when the crew will have a real threat to life on the station, then probably the danger of staying on the station can be higher than going down in an unhealthy Soyuz,” Sergei Krikalev, Russia’s chief of crewed space programs, said.

The incident has disrupted Russia’s ISS activities, forcing its cosmonauts to call off spacewalks as officials focus on the leaky capsule, which serves as a lifeboat for the crew.

The leak is also a problem for NASA. The U.S. agency said last month it was exploring whether SpaceX’s Crew Dragon spacecraft could offer an alternative ride home for some ISS crew members, in case Russia was unable to launch another Soyuz.

Both NASA and Roscosmos believe the leak was caused by a micrometeoroid – a small particle of space rock – hitting the capsule at high velocity.

“Space is not a safe place, and not a safe environment. We have meteorites, we have a vacuum and we have a high temperature and we have complicated hardware that can fail,” Krikalev said.

“Now we are facing one of the scenarios … we are prepared for this situation.”

Western Europe’s first satellite launch mission takes off

  • Converted Boeing 747 takes off from Newquay, Cornwall
  • Rocket will be deployed over the Atlantic in next hour
  • ‘Start Me Up’ mission will deploy nine small satellites

NEWQUAY, England, Jan 9 (Reuters) – Virgin Orbit’s “Cosmic Girl” carrier aircraft took off from Newquay’s spaceport in Cornwall, southwest England on Monday night, the initial stage of Western Europe’s first ever satellite launch.

The modified Boeing 747 with a rocket under its wing took to the air and then soared out over the Atlantic Ocean, where after an hour it will release a rocket at about 35,000 feet (10,668 meters).

More than 2,000 space fans cheered when the aircraft left the runway.

The “horizontal” launch has catapulted the resort in southwest England – population 20,000 and famous for its reliable Atlantic waves – into the limelight as Western Europe’s go-to destination for small satellites.

Virgin Orbit (VORB.O), part-owned by British billionaire Richard Branson, said nine satellites would be deployed into lower Earth orbit (LEO) from its LauncherOne rocket in its first mission outside its United States base.

NASA mulls SpaceX backup plan for crew of Russia’s leaky Soyuz ship

  • NASA asks SpaceX about its Crew Dragon backup capabilities
  • NASA, Russia’s space agency probing cause of Soyuz leak
  • Three-man Soyuz crew’s return ride from space station unclear

WASHINGTON, Dec 28 (Reuters) – NASA is exploring whether SpaceX’s Crew Dragon spacecraft can potentially offer an alternative ride home for some crew members of the International Space Station after a Russian capsule sprang a coolant leak while docked to the orbital lab.

NASA and Russia’s space agency, Roscosmos, are investigating the cause of a punctured coolant line on an external radiator of Russia’s Soyuz MS-22 spacecraft, which is supposed to return its crew of two cosmonauts and one U.S. astronaut to Earth early next year.

But the Dec. 14 leak, which emptied the Soyuz of a vital fluid used to regulate crew cabin temperatures, has derailed Russia’s space station routines, with engineers in Moscow examining whether to launch another Soyuz to retrieve the three-man team that flew to ISS aboard the crippled MS-22 craft.

If Russia cannot launch another Soyuz ship, or decides for some reason that doing so would be too risky, NASA is weighing another option.

“We have asked SpaceX a few questions on their capability to return additional crew members on Dragon if necessary, but that is not our prime focus at this time,” NASA spokeswoman Sandra Jones said in a statement to Reuters.

SpaceX did not respond to a Reuters request for comment.

It was unclear what NASA specifically asked of SpaceX’s Crew Dragon capabilities, such as whether the company can find a way to increase the crew capacity of the Dragon currently docked to the station, or launch an empty capsule for the crew’s rescue.

But the company’s potential involvement in a mission led by Russia underscores the degree of precaution NASA is taking to ensure its astronauts can safely return to Earth, should one of the other contingency plans arranged by Russia fall through.

The leaky Soyuz capsule ferried U.S. astronaut Frank Rubio and cosmonauts Sergey Prokopyev and Dimitri Petelin to the space station in September for a six-month mission. They were scheduled to return to Earth in March 2023.

The station’s four other crew members – two more from NASA, a third Russian cosmonaut and a Japanese astronaut – arrived in October via a NASA-contracted SpaceX Crew Dragon capsule, which also remains parked at the ISS.

SpaceX’s Crew Dragon capsule, a gumdrop-shaped pod with four astronaut seats, has become the centerpiece to NASA’s human spaceflight efforts in low-Earth orbit. Besides Russia’s Soyuz program, it is the only entity capable of ferrying humans to the space station and back.

THREE POSSIBLE CULPRITS

Finding what caused the leak could factor into decisions about the best way to return the crew members. A meteroid-caused puncture, a strike from a piece of space debris or a hardware failure on the Soyuz capsule itself are three possible causes of the leak that NASA and Roscosmos are investigating.

A hardware malfunction could raise additional questions for Roscosmos about the integrity of other Soyuz vehicles, such as the one it might send for the crew’s rescue, said Mike Suffredini, who led NASA’s ISS program for a decade until 2015.

“I can assure you that’s something they’re looking at, to see what’s back there and whether there’s a concern for it,” he said. “The thing about the Russians is they’re really good at not talking about what they’re doing, but they’re very thorough.”

Roscosmos chief Yuri Borisov had previously said engineers would decide by Tuesday how to return the crew to Earth, but the agency said that day it would make the decision in January.

NASA has previously said the capsule’s temperatures remain “within acceptable limits,” with its crew compartment currently being vented with air flow allowed through an open hatch to the ISS.

Sergei Krikalev, Russia’s chief of crewed space programs, told reporters last week that the temperature would rise rapidly if the hatch to the station were closed.

NASA and Roscosmos are primarily focusing on determining the leak’s cause, Jones said, as well as the health of MS-22 which is also meant to serve as the three-man crew’s lifeboat in case an emergency on the station requires evacuation.

A recent meteor shower initially seemed to raise the odds of a micrometeoroid strike as the culprit, but the leak was facing the wrong way for that to be the case, NASA’s ISS program manager Joel Montalbano told reporters last week, though a space rock could have come from another direction.

And if a piece of space debris is to blame, it could fuel concerns of an increasingly messy orbital environment and raise questions about whether such vital equipment as the spacecraft’s coolant line should have been protected by debris shielding, as other parts of the MS-22 spacecraft are.

“We are not shielded against everything throughout the space station,” Suffredini said. “We can’t shield against everything.”

Elon Musk says around 100 Starlinks now active in Iran

Dec 26 (Reuters) – SpaceX Chief Executive Elon Musk said on Monday that the company is now close to having 100 active Starlinks, the firm’s satellite internet service, in Iran, three months after he tweeted he would activate the service there amid protests around the Islamic country.

Musk said, “approaching 100 starlinks active in Iran”, in a tweet on Monday.

The billionaire had said in September that he would activate Starlink in Iran as part of a U.S.-backed effort “to advance internet freedom and the free flow of information” to Iranians.

The satellite-based broadband service could help Iranians circumvent the government’s restrictions on accessing the internet and certain social media platforms amid protests around the country.

The Islamic Republic has been engulfed in protests that erupted after the death in September of 22-year-old Mahsa Amini in police custody after being arrested by the morality police for wearing “unsuitable attire”.

Iran reroutes plane carrying soccer star’s wife, blames UK over unrest

DUBAI, Dec 26 (Reuters) – Iranian authorities rerouted a flight bound for Dubai on Monday and prevented the wife and daughter of former national soccer team captain Ali Daei, who has supported anti-government protests, from leaving the country, state media reported.

Amid a concerted clampdown, Tehran also said the arrests in Iran of citizens linked to Britain reflected its “destructive role” in the more than three months of unrest.

People from across Iran’s social spectrum have joined one of the most sustained challenges to the country’s ruling theocracy since the 1979 Islamic Revolution, relying heavily on social media platforms – which the government is trying to shut down – to organise and spread news of demonstrations.

A service that could help Iranians circumvent internet restrictions is Starlink, a satellite-based broadband service operated by Elon Musk’s SpaceX.

Musk said on Monday that the company was getting close to having 100 active Starlink satellite receivers inside Iran.

Meanwhile Daei’s wife was banned from travelling abroad, Iran’s judiciary said, after authorities ordered the Mahan Air plane she had been a passenger in to land on Iran’s Kish Island in the Gulf.

“I really don’t know the reason for this. Did they want to arrest a terrorist?” Daei told semi-official news agency ISNA.

After he voiced support for the protests on social media, authorities this month shut down a jewellery shop and a restaurant he owned.

The protests were triggered by the Sept. 16 death in detention of Mahsa Amini, a 22-year-old Kurdish Iranian held for wearing “inappropriate attire” under Iran’s strict Islamic dress code for women.

Iran has accused Western countries, Israel and Saudi Arabia of fomenting the unrest, allegations accompanied by arrests of dozens of dual nationals, part of an official narrative designed to shift blame away from the Iranian leadership.

Asked by a reporter to comment on Sunday’s announcement of the arrest of seven people linked to Britain, Iran’s foreign ministry spokesperson Nasser Kanaani said: “Some countries, especially the one you mentioned, had an unconstructive role regarding the recent developments in Iran.

“Their role was totally destructive and incited the riots.”

The British foreign ministry had said it was seeking further information from Iranian authorities on the reported arrests.

Rights group HRANA says about 18,500 people have been arrested during the unrest. Government officials say most have been released.

Besides arrests, authorities have imposed travel bans on dozens of artists, lawyers, journalists and celebrities for endorsing the protests.

HRANA also said that as of Dec. 25, 507 protesters had been killed, including 69 minors, as well as 66 members of the security forces.

Iran’s troubled rial currency on Monday fell to a record low of 415,400 against the dollar, according to forex site Bonbast.com. It has lost about 24% of its value since the protests began, as Iranians grappling with official inflation of about 50% buy dollars and gold in an effort to protect their savings.

Unexplained leak from docked Soyuz spacecraft cancels Russian ISS spacewalk

Dec 14 (Reuters) – A routine spacewalk by two Russian cosmonauts aboard the International Space Station (ISS) was called off as it was about to begin after flight controllers noticed a stream of liquid spewing from a docked Soyuz spacecraft, a NASA webcast showed.

The spray of fluid, which was visible in NASA’s live video feed as a torrent of snowflake-like particles emanating from the rear section of the Soyuz MS-22 capsule, was described by a NASA commentator as a coolant leak.

NASA said none of the seven members of the current International Space Station (ISS) crew – three Russian cosmonauts, three U.S. NASA astronauts and a Japanese astronaut – was ever in any danger.

The mishap occurred just as two of the cosmonauts, crew commander Sergey Prokopyev and flight engineer Dimitri Petelin, were suited and preparing for a planned spacewalk to move a radiator from one module to another on the Russian segment of the ISS.

An official for Russia’s mission control operations near Moscow was heard telling Prokopyev and Petelin in a radio transmission that their spacewalk was being canceled while engineers worked to determine the nature and origin of the leak.

The NASA commentator on the livestream, Rob Navias, broadcasting from NASA’s Johnson Space Center in Houston, also said the spacewalk was called off because of the leak, which he said began about 7:45 p.m. EST (0145 GMT Thursday).

Navias said the Soyuz craft arrived at the space station in September, bringing Prokopyev, Petelin and U.S. astronaut Frank Rubio to the ISS, and has remained attached to the Earth-facing side of the orbital laboratory.

The spacewalk planned for Wednesday was postponed once before, in late November, because of faulty cooling pumps in the cosmonauts’ spacesuits, Navias said.

The spacewalk was to be the 12th this year at the ISS and the 257th in the history of the 22-year-old platform for assembly, maintenance and upgrade work, according to NASA.

Navias said it was too soon to know what implications the leak might have for the integrity of that spacecraft, and whether it might pose any difficulties for returning crew to Earth at the end of their mission.

Five other spacecraft are parked at the space station – two SpaceX capsules (a Crew Dragon and Cargo Dragon), a Northrop Grumman Cygnus space freighter and two Russian resupply ships, Progress 81 and Progress 82.

The ISS, spanning the length of a U.S. football field and orbiting some 250 miles above Earth, has been continuously occupied since 2000, operated by a U.S.-Russian-led partnership that includes Canada, Japan and 11 European countries.

Japanese billionaire Maezawa picks K-pop star TOP, DJ Steve Aoki to join SpaceX moon trip

TOKYO, Dec 9 (Reuters) – Japanese billionaire Yusaku Maezawa revealed on Friday that K-pop star TOP and DJ Steve Aoki will be among the eight crew members he plans to take on a trip around the moon as soon as next year, hitching a ride on one of Elon Musk’s SpaceX rockets.

Maezawa bought every seat on the maiden lunar voyage, which has been in the works since 2018 and would follow his trip on a Soyuz spacecraft to the International Space Station (ISS) for a 12-day stint last year.

The picks were announced by Maezawa on Twitter and at a website for what he dubbed the #dearMoon Project.

The fashion tycoon and his crew would become the first passengers on the SpaceX flyby of the moon as commercial firms, including Jeff Bezos’ Blue Origin, usher in a new age of space travel for wealthy clients.

The mission aboard SpaceX’s Starship vehicle is scheduled to take eight days from launch to return to earth, including three days circling the moon, coming within 200 kilometres from the lunar surface. Though the flight was scheduled for 2023, it is facing delays due to ongoing tests of the spacecraft and its rockets.

Like fellow billionaire Musk, Maezawa has a flare for promotion and an infatuation with Twitter — he has boasted to holding the Guinness world record for the most retweeted post, when he offered a cash prize of 1 million yen ($7300) to 100 winners for retweeting it.

Maezawa used the micro-blogging site to recruit eight crew members from around the world to join him on the moon trip, saying 1 million people had applied.

TOP, the stage name of Choi Seung Hyun who broke out with the K-pop group Big Bang, is among the higher profile members selected, along with Aoki, a Japanese-American musician and DJ whose father founded the Benihana restaurant chain.

“I feel great pride and responsibility in becoming the first Korean civilian going to the moon,” TOP said in a video posted after the announcement.

Indian actor Dev Joshi was also among the picks for the group, comprised largely of artists and photographers. U.S. Olympic snowboarder Kaitlyn Farrington and Japanese dancer Miyu were named as backup crew members.

Maezawa, 47, flagged an update to the lunar expedition on Monday, tweeting he’d held an online meeting with Musk and was readying a “big announcement about space.”

Maezawa made his fortune founding the online fashion retailer Zozo Inc (3092.T), in which Softbank Group Corp’s (9984.T) internet business is now the top shareholder.
